![matlab standard deviation matlab standard deviation](http://www.cs.utsa.edu/~cs1173/experiments/Experiment2PopulationStandardDeviationEstimation/Experiment2PopulationStandardDeviationEstimation_03.png)
For flag = 1, std(X,1) returns the standard deviation using (2) above, producing the second moment of the sample about its mean.Ĭomputes the standard deviations along the dimension of X specified by scalar dim. In my project I can not use std function. where n is the number of rows in a single column vector, but the result is different as calculated by std (h). I thought maybe python’s implementation was incorrect. I found this out after messing with python’s implementation of a standard deviation filter for half an hour. If X is a multidimensional array, std(X) is the standard deviation of the elements along the first nonsingleton dimension of X.įor flag = 0, is the same as std(X). y Fit data shape, loc, scale (degrees, floc0) Parameters sigma shape standard deviation mu math.log(scale). I am trying to calculate the standard deviation in MATLAB using the formula. The default standard deviation in Matlab and python do not return the same value. A high standard deviation means that values are generally far from the mean, while a low standard deviation indicates that values are clustered close to the mean. It tells you, on average, how far each value lies from the mean. If X is a matrix, std(X) returns a row vector containing the standard deviation of the elements of each column of X. The standard deviation is the average amount of variability in your dataset.
![matlab standard deviation matlab standard deviation](https://www.mathworks.com/help/examples/graphics/win64/ModifyErrorBarsAfterCreationExample_02.png)
The result s is the square root of an unbiased estimator of the variance of the population from which X is drawn, as long as X consists of independent, identically distributed samples. Where X is a vector, returns the standard deviation using (1) above. Note that the 'sample' standard deviation does equal the square root of the 'sample.
![matlab standard deviation matlab standard deviation](https://it.mathworks.com/help/matlab/ref/sum_vecdim.png)
But that result does not seem to be the same as the square root of the population variance: sqrt (var (example,1)) ans 0.0091. The two forms of the equation differ only in versus in the divisor. In MATLAB, adding 'Population' does give a result different from plain std (): test1std (example,'Population') test1 0.0087. Details: In the sliding window method, a window of specified length is moved over the data. How can I get the standard deviation from gaussian fitted curve in Matlab It's not an Output of fit function. There are two common textbook definitions for the standard deviation s of a data vector X.Īnd is the number of elements in the sample. Moving standard deviation - MATLAB - MathWorks Deutschland.
MATLAB STANDARD DEVIATION FREE
You will be provided with free access to MATLAB for the duration of the specialization to complete your work.Std (MATLAB Functions) MATLAB Function Reference MATLAB is the go-to choice for millions of people working in engineering and science, and provides the capabilities you need to accomplish your data science tasks. returns a row vector containing the standard deviation of the elements of each column of X. Throughout this specialization, you will be using MATLAB. To be successful in completing the courses, you should have some background in basic statistics (histograms, averages, standard deviation, curve fitting, interpolation). This specialization assumes you have domain expertise in a technical field and some exposure to computational tools, such as spreadsheets. Being able to visualize, analyze, and model data are some of the most in-demand career skills from fields ranging from healthcare, to the auto industry, to tech startups.
MATLAB STANDARD DEVIATION SOFTWARE
Do you find yourself in an industry or field that increasingly uses data to answer questions? Are you working with an overwhelming amount of data and need to make sense of it? Do you want to avoid becoming a full-time software developer or statistician to do meaningful tasks with your data?Ĭompleting this specialization will give you the skills and confidence you need to achieve practical results in Data Science quickly.